The complete homeowner’s guide to finish carpentry often comes up when homeowners are planning interior upgrades or renovations that require precise woodwork and detailed craftsmanship. People searching for this topic typically want to understand how finish carpentry can enhance the appearance and functionality of their living spaces. This includes installing or upgrading features like crown molding, baseboards, wainscoting, door and window casings, built-in shelving, and custom trim work. These projects are usually aimed at elevating the aesthetic appeal of a home’s interior, creating a polished look that reflects personal style and attention to detail.

Finish carpentry is closely related to a variety of home improvement plans and common problems homeowners encounter. For instance, many seek finish carpentry services when remodeling a room or finishing a basement to add architectural character or to cover up imperfections. It can also be part of a larger renovation involving kitchen or bathroom upgrades, where custom millwork and cabinetry are needed. In some cases, homeowners want to replace outdated or damaged trim and moldings to restore a home’s original charm or to modernize its interior. These projects often require careful measurements and precise installation to ensure a seamless, professional appearance.

The types of properties where finish carpentry services are most often requested tend to be residential homes, including single-family houses, townhomes, and condominiums. These properties typically feature interior spaces that benefit from detailed woodwork and decorative elements. Older homes, in particular, may have original trim and moldings that need restoration or replacement, while newer homes may incorporate custom finishes to add unique character. What is finish carpentry? Finish carpentry involves detailed woodwork such as trim, moldings, cabinetry, and other decorative elements that enhance the appearance of a home’s interior. Local contractors specializing in finish carpentry can handle these precise installations to improve your space.

What types of projects are covered by finish carpentry services? Finish carpentry services typically include installing baseboards, crown molding, door and window casings, built-in shelves, and custom cabinetry. Local service providers can assist with all these elements to complete your home’s interior design.

How do finish carpentry services improve a home's interior? Finish carpentry adds aesthetic detail and polished craftsmanship to interior spaces, creating a cohesive and refined look. Local pros can help achieve professional-quality results for your decorative woodwork needs.

What skills are involved in finish carpentry? Finish carpentry requires precision measuring, detailed cutting, fitting, and installation of decorative wood components. Local carpentry specialists bring the expertise needed to execute these intricate tasks effectively.
